The Early Cretaceous (Neocomian) carbonate deposits of the Transylvanian carbonate Platform
(Patrulius et al., 1976) are well-developed, with a nearly complete geological section along the
Lapoş Valley, Bicaz Gorges (Eastern Carpathians), forming the Lapoş Formation. From this
section, several foraminifera (Anchispirocyclina lusitanica, species of the genus Andersenolina,
Everticyclammina virguliana, E. kelleri, E. greigi), along with new taxa: Streptocyclammina
orientalis n. sp. (Fam. Spirocyclinidae), Buccicrenata maynci n. sp., Pseudocyclammina
transylvanica n. sp. (Fam. Cyclamminidae) and Mohlerina n. sp. are described. The Berriasian
Everticyclammina irregularis( Dragastan 1989 non 1975) is here transferred to the genus
Buccicrenata and, thus, becomes B. irregularis (Dragastan, 1989) Dragastan nov. comb. Algae
and algal nodules are also described from these foraminifera-bearing assemblages; their age is
calibrated through correlation with the calpionellid zonation.
